Charles Fagan is a Neurologist in Birmingham, Alabama. Dr. Fagan is highly rated in 6 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Seizures, Memory Loss, Generalized Tonic-Clonic Seizure, and Paraplegia.

MediFind evaluates expertise by pulling from factors such as number of articles a doctor has published in medical journals, participation in clinical trials, speaking at industry conferences, prescribing and referral patterns, and strength of connections with other experts in their field.
